Pasco deputies search for car break-in suspect
NEW PORT RICHEY (FOX 13) - The Pasco County Sheriff's Office is asking for the community's help to find the people responsible for a spree of break-ins Sunday morning.
Deputies say late Sunday morning, six vehicles had their windows broken in the parking lots of Starkey Wilderness Park in New Port Richey.
Investigators say credit cards were taken and later used at a Walmart in Tarpon Springs. The photos released by the sheriff's office could be the suspect from the burglaries.
